To the choirmaster. A Psalm of David.
(19-2) The heavens declare the glory of God, and the firmament proclaims the work of His hands;
2
(19-3) day unto day pours forth speech, and night unto night reveals knowledge.
3
(19-4) There is no speech, and there are no words; their voice is not heard;
4
(19-5) yet their sound goes out through all the earth, and their words to the end of the world. In them He has set a tent for the sun,
5
(19-6) which comes forth like a bridegroom leaving his chamber, rejoicing like a strong man to run his course.
6
(19-7) Its rising is from the end of the heavens, and its circuit to the other end of them; and nothing is hidden from its heat.
7
(19-8) The law of the LORD is perfect, restoring the soul; the testimony of the LORD is sure, making wise the simple.
8
(19-9) The precepts of the LORD are right, rejoicing the heart; the commandment of the LORD is pure, enlightening the eyes.
9
(19-10) The fear of the LORD is clean, enduring forever; the judgments of the LORD are true, altogether righteous,
10
(19-11) more to be desired than gold, even much fine gold; sweeter also than honey, and the drippings of the honeycomb.
11
(19-12) Moreover, by them is Your servant warned; and in keeping them there is great reward.
12
(19-13) Who can discern his errors? Cleanse me from hidden faults.
13
(19-14) Keep back Your servant also from presumptuous sins; let them not have dominion over me! Then I shall be blameless, and I shall be innocent of great transgression.
14
(19-15) Let the words of my mouth and the meditation of my heart be acceptable in Your sight, O LORD, my rock and my redeemer.
🕊️🙏📖 Summary of Psalm 19 – “The Glory of God in Creation and His Word”
Psalm 19 is a beautiful psalm that joins together two chief revelations from God: the universe and His word. David begins by praising the glory of God seen in the heavens and in creation, then turns to the majesty of God’s law, which is perfect and restores the soul.
At last, David confesses human weakness and prays that his life may be pleasing before God. This is a poem that joins the beauty of the cosmos, the power of the word, and man’s need for grace.
📌 1. The Heavens Declare the Glory of God (verses 1–6)
➡️ “The heavens declare the glory of God, and the firmament proclaims the work of His hands.”
➡️ The sun is pictured like a bridegroom and a hero running his course — full of vigor.
➡️ There is no place on earth that does not hear the “voice” of creation.
🎯 The universe is a silent witness to the power and glory of the Creator.
📌 2. God’s Word: Perfect and Life-Giving (verses 7–11)
➡️ God’s law is perfect, trustworthy, right, pure, and just.
➡️ It gives wisdom, rejoices the heart, enlightens the eyes, and is sweeter than honey.
➡️ The word also warns and gives great reward to those who keep it.
🎯 God’s word is not only command, but a source of joy, life, and protection.
📌 3. A Prayer to Be Cleansed and to Live Acceptably (verses 12–14)
➡️ David acknowledges hidden sin and asks to be kept from great transgression.
➡️ He desires that the words of his mouth and the meditation of his heart be pleasing before God.
➡️ “O LORD, my rock and my redeemer.”
🎯 The more one understands the glory of God, the more one becomes aware of the need for grace and cleansing.
📖 Main Teaching
- The natural creation is proof of God’s glory and greatness
- God’s word is the written revelation that gives wisdom and life
- The life of a believer must be grounded in meditation on and obedience to the word
- Spiritual honesty includes awareness of hidden sin
- The chief aim of life is to be pleasing before God
